André Stark
About
André Stark has authored 121 papers that have received a total of 3.8k indexed citations.
This includes 78 papers in Surgery, 19 papers in Molecular Biology and 13 papers in Rheumatology. The topics of these papers are Orthopaedic implants and arthroplasty (48 papers), Total Knee Arthroplasty Outcomes (33 papers) and Orthopedic Infections and Treatments (29 papers). André Stark is often cited by papers focused on Orthopaedic implants and arthroplasty (48 papers), Total Knee Arthroplasty Outcomes (33 papers) and Orthopedic Infections and Treatments (29 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in Sweden, United States and United Kingdom. André Stark's co-authors include Olof Sköldenberg, Olle Muren, Rüdiger J Weiss, Thomas Eisler and Nils P. Hailer and has published in prestigious journals such as Blood, Biochemical and Biophysical Research Communications and Pain.
